2014-10-03qdisc: validate skb without holding lockEric Dumazet
Validation of skb can be pretty expensive : GSO segmentation and/or checksum computations. We can do this without holding qdisc lock, so that other cpus can queue additional packets. Trick is that requeued packets were already validated, so we carry a boolean so that sch_direct_xmit() can validate a fresh skb list, or directly use an old one. Tested on 40Gb NIC (8 TX queues) and 200 concurrent flows, 48 threads host. Turning TSO on or off had no effect on throughput, only few more cpu cycles. Lock contention on qdisc lock disappeared. 2014-10-03net/rds: fix possible double free on sock tear downHerton R. Krzesinski
I got a report of a double free happening at RDS slab cache. One suspicion was that may be somewhere we were doing a sock_hold/sock_put on an already freed sock. Thus after providing a kernel with the following change: static inline void sock_hold(struct sock *sk) { - atomic_inc(&sk->sk_refcnt); + if (!atomic_inc_not_zero(&sk->sk_refcnt)) + WARN(1, "Trying to hold sock already gone: %p (family: %hd)\n", + sk, sk->sk_family); } The warning successfuly triggered: Trying to hold sock already gone: ffff81f6dda61280 (family: 21) WARNING: at include/net/sock.h:350 sock_hold() Call Trace: <IRQ> [<ffffffff8adac135>] :rds:rds_send_remove_from_sock+0xf0/0x21b [<ffffffff8adad35c>] :rds:rds_send_drop_acked+0xbf/0xcf [<ffffffff8addf546>] :rds_rdma:rds_ib_recv_tasklet_fn+0x256/0x2dc [<ffffffff8009899a>] tasklet_action+0x8f/0x12b [<ffffffff800125a2>] __do_softirq+0x89/0x133 [<ffffffff8005f30c>] call_softirq+0x1c/0x28 [<ffffffff8006e644>] do_softirq+0x2c/0x7d [<ffffffff8006e4d4>] do_IRQ+0xee/0xf7 [<ffffffff8005e625>] ret_from_intr+0x0/0xa <EOI> Looking at the call chain above, the only way I think this would be possible is if somewhere we already released the same socket->sock which is assigned to the rds_message at rds_send_remove_from_sock. Which seems only possible to happen after the tear down done on rds_release. rds_release properly calls rds_send_drop_to to drop the socket from any rds_message, and some proper synchronization is in place to avoid race with rds_send_drop_acked/rds_send_remove_from_sock. However, I still see a very narrow window where it may be possible we touch a sock already released: when rds_release races with rds_send_drop_acked, we check RDS_MSG_ON_CONN to avoid cleanup on the same rds_message, but in this specific case we don't clear rm->m_rs. In this case, it seems we could then go on at rds_send_drop_to and after it returns, the sock is freed by last sock_put on rds_release, with concurrently we being at rds_send_remove_from_sock; then at some point in the loop at rds_send_remove_from_sock we process an rds_message which didn't have rm->m_rs unset for a freed sock, and a possible sock_hold on an sock already gone at rds_release happens. This hopefully address the described condition above and avoids a double free on "second last" sock_put. In addition, I removed the comment about socket destruction on top of rds_send_drop_acked: we call rds_send_drop_to in rds_release and we should have things properly serialized there, thus I can't see the comment being accurate there. 2014-10-03net/rds: do proper house keeping if connection fails in rds_tcp_conn_connectHerton R. Krzesinski
I see two problems if we consider the sock->ops->connect attempt to fail in rds_tcp_conn_connect. The first issue is that for example we don't remove the previously added rds_tcp_connection item to rds_tcp_tc_list at rds_tcp_set_callbacks, which means that on a next reconnect attempt for the same rds_connection, when rds_tcp_conn_connect is called we can again call rds_tcp_set_callbacks, resulting in duplicated items on rds_tcp_tc_list, leading to list corruption: to avoid this just make sure we call properly rds_tcp_restore_callbacks before we exit. The second issue is that we should also release the sock properly, by setting sock = NULL only if we are returning without error. Signed-off-by: Herton R. 2014-10-03Merge branch 'qdisc_bulk_dequeue'David S. Miller
Jesper Dangaard Brouer says: ==================== qdisc: bulk dequeue support This patchset uses DaveM's recent API changes to dev_hard_start_xmit(), from the qdisc layer, to implement dequeue bulking. Patch01: "qdisc: bulk dequeue support for qdiscs with TCQ_F_ONETXQUEUE" - Implement basic qdisc dequeue bulking - This time, 100% relying on BQL limits, no magic safe-guard constants Patch02: "qdisc: dequeue bulking also pickup GSO/TSO packets" - Extend bulking to bulk several GSO/TSO packets - Seperate patch, as it introduce a small regression, see test section. We do have a patch03, which exports a userspace tunable as a BQL tunable, that can byte-cap or disable the bulking/bursting. But we could not agree on it internally, thus not sending it now. We basically strive to avoid adding any new userspace tunable. Testing patch01: ================ Demonstrating the performance improvement of qdisc dequeue bulking, is tricky because the effect only "kicks-in" once the qdisc system have a backlog. Thus, for a backlog to form, we need either 1) to exceed wirespeed of the link or 2) exceed the capability of the device driver. For practical use-cases, the measureable effect of this will be a reduction in CPU usage 01-TCP_STREAM: -------------- Testing effect for TCP involves disabling TSO and GSO, because TCP already benefit from bulking, via TSO and especially for GSO segmented packets. This patch view TSO/GSO as a seperate kind of bulking, and avoid further bulking of these packet types. The measured perf diff benefit (at 10Gbit/s) for a single netperf TCP_STREAM were 9.24% less CPU used on calls to _raw_spin_lock() (mostly from sch_direct_xmit). If my E5-2695v2(ES) CPU is tuned according to: http://netoptimizer.blogspot.dk/2014/04/basic-tuning-for-network-overload.html Then it is possible that a single netperf TCP_STREAM, with GSO and TSO disabled, can utilize all bandwidth on a 10Gbit/s link. This will then cause a standing backlog queue at the qdisc layer. Trying to pressure the system some more CPU util wise, I'm starting 24x TCP_STREAMs and monitoring the overall CPU utilization. This confirms bulking saves CPU cycles when it "kicks-in". Tool mpstat, while stressing the system with netperf 24x TCP_STREAM, shows: * Disabled bulking: sys:2.58% soft:8.50% idle:88.78% * Enabled bulking: sys:2.43% soft:7.66% idle:89.79% 02-UDP_STREAM ------------- The measured perf diff benefit for UDP_STREAM were 6.41% less CPU used on calls to _raw_spin_lock(). 24x UDP_STREAM with packet size -m 1472 (to avoid sending UDP/IP fragments). 03-trafgen driver test ---------------------- The performance of the 10Gbit/s ixgbe driver is limited due to updating the HW ring-queue tail-pointer on every packet. As previously demonstrated with pktgen. Using trafgen to send RAW frames from userspace (via AF_PACKET), and forcing it through qdisc path (with option --qdisc-path and -t0), sending with 12 CPUs. I can demonstrate this driver layer limitation: * 12.8 Mpps with no qdisc bulking * 14.8 Mpps with qdisc bulking (full 10G-wirespeed) Testing patch02: ================ Testing Bulking several GSO/TSO packets: Measuring HoL (Head-of-Line) blocking for TSO and GSO, with netperf-wrapper. Bulking several TSO show no performance regressions (requeues were in the area 32 requeues/sec for 10G while transmitting approx 813Kpps). Bulking several GSOs does show small regression or very small improvement (requeues were in the area 8000 requeues/sec, for 10G while transmitting approx 813Kpps). Using ixgbe 10Gbit/s with GSO bulking, we can measure some additional latency. Base-case, which is "normal" GSO bulking, sees varying high-prio queue delay between 0.38ms to 0.47ms. Bulking several GSOs together, result in a stable high-prio queue delay of 0.50ms. Corrosponding to: (10000*10^6)*((0.50-0.47)/10^3)/8 = 37500 bytes (10000*10^6)*((0.50-0.38)/10^3)/8 = 150000 bytes 37500/1500 = 25 pkts 150000/1500 = 100 pkts Using igb at 100Mbit/s with GSO bulking, shows an improvement. Base-case sees varying high-prio queue delay between 2.23ms to 2.35ms diff of 0.12ms corrosponding to 1500 bytes at 100Mbit/s. 2014-10-03qdisc: bulk dequeue support for qdiscs with TCQ_F_ONETXQUEUEJesper Dangaard Brouer
Based on DaveM's recent API work on dev_hard_start_xmit(), that allows sending/processing an entire skb list. This patch implements qdisc bulk dequeue, by allowing multiple packets to be dequeued in dequeue_skb(). The optimization principle for this is two fold, (1) to amortize locking cost and (2) avoid expensive tailptr update for notifying HW. (1) Several packets are dequeued while holding the qdisc root_lock, amortizing locking cost over several packet. The dequeued SKB list is processed under the TXQ lock in dev_hard_start_xmit(), thus also amortizing the cost of the TXQ lock. (2) Further more, dev_hard_start_xmit() will utilize the skb->xmit_more API to delay HW tailptr update, which also reduces the cost per packet. One restriction of the new API is that every SKB must belong to the same TXQ. This patch takes the easy way out, by restricting bulk dequeue to qdisc's with the TCQ_F_ONETXQUEUE flag, that specifies the qdisc only have attached a single TXQ. Some detail about the flow; dev_hard_start_xmit() will process the skb list, and transmit packets individually towards the driver (see xmit_one()). In case the driver stops midway in the list, the remaining skb list is returned by dev_hard_start_xmit(). In sch_direct_xmit() this returned list is requeued by dev_requeue_skb(). To avoid overshooting the HW limits, which results in requeuing, the patch limits the amount of bytes dequeued, based on the drivers BQL limits. In-effect bulking will only happen for BQL enabled drivers. Small amounts for extra HoL blocking (2x MTU/0.24ms) were measured at 100Mbit/s, with bulking 8 packets, but the oscillating nature of the measurement indicate something, like sched latency might be causing this effect. More comparisons show, that this oscillation goes away occationally. Thus, we disregard this artifact completely and remove any "magic" bulking limit. For now, as a conservative approach, stop bulking when seeing TSO and segmented GSO packets. They already benefit from bulking on their own. 2014-10-03ASoC: tlv320aic3x: fix PLL D configurationDmitry Lavnikevich
Current caching implementation during regcache_sync() call bypasses all register writes of values that are already known as default (regmap reg_defaults). Same time in TLV320AIC3x codecs register 5 (AIC3X_PLL_PROGC_REG) write should be immediately followed by register 6 write (AIC3X_PLL_PROGD_REG) even if it was not changed. Otherwise both registers will not be written. This brings to issue that appears particulary in case of 44.1kHz playback with 19.2MHz master clock. In this case AIC3X_PLL_PROGC_REG is 0x6e while AIC3X_PLL_PROGD_REG is 0x0 (same as register default). Thus AIC3X_PLL_PROGC_REG also remains not written and we get wrong playback speed. In this patch snd_soc_read() is used to get cached pll values and snd_soc_write() (unlike regcache_sync() this function doesn't bypasses hardware default values) to write them to registers. 2014-10-03PM / clk: Fix crash in clocks management code if !CONFIG_PM_RUNTIMEGeert Uytterhoeven
Unlike the clocks management code for runtime PM, the code used for system suspend does not check the pm_clock_entry.status field. If pm_clk_acquire() failed, ce->status will be PCE_STATUS_ERROR, and ce->clk will be a negative error code (e.g. 0xfffffffe = -2 = -ENOENT). Depending on the clock implementation, suspend or resume may crash with: Unable to handle kernel NULL pointer dereference at virtual address 00000026 (CCF clk_disable() has an IS_ERR_OR_NULL() check, while CCF clk_enable() only has a NULL check; pre-CCF implementations may behave differently) While just checking for PCE_STATUS_ERROR would be sufficient, it doesn't hurt to use the same state machine as is done for runtime PM, as this makes the two versions more similar, and eligible for a future consolidation.
